What is a Foldable Walker?
A foldable walker is a mobility aid developed to offer assistance and stability to people who have problem walking individually. It typically consists of a lightweight frame made from products like aluminum or steel, and can quickly be folded for storage or transportation. This feature sets foldable walkers apart from standard walkers, making them a convenient choice for users on the go.

Picking the Right Foldable Walker
Selecting the suitable foldable walker involves factor to consider of a number of aspects, including user needs, lifestyle, and physical characteristics. Here are some essential elements to consider:
User's Physical Condition: Assess the level of mobility and support the user needs. Figure out if extra features such as wheels or a seat are essential.
Adjustable Height: Ensure that the walker can be changed to the user's height for optimal support and comfort.
Weight Capacity: Check the weight limitation of the walker to guarantee it appropriates for the user's body weight.
Product Quality: Consider walkers made from lightweight yet sturdy products for toughness without compromising ease of motion.

Q1: Can foldable walkers be used outdoors?A1: Yes, many
foldable walkers are created for both indoor and outdoor use. However, choices with bigger wheels and durable frames are more effective for outdoor terrains.
Q2: How do I clean and keep a foldable walker?A2: Clean the walker frequently with a wet cloth and moderate detergent. Look for any loose parts or damage before each use, and keep the wheels without particles. Q3: Are foldable walkers adjustable in
height?A3: Most foldable walkers come with adjustable height settings to accommodate different users. It's necessary to change the height properly for optimal assistance. Q4: What is the average weight of a foldable walker?A4: The weight of a foldable walker
can vary based on material and design, however they normally
weigh between 5 to 10 pounds for ease of use. Q5: Can people who are completely independent use foldable walkers?A5: While developed primarily for those requiring
assistance, even totally independent individuals might use foldable walkers for extra stability in particular situations, such as irregular terrain.
